“Charlene Li is absolutely at the top of her game. She’s an expert in social technology—an absolute essential in driving your company forward today. But what’s more, she clearly lays out what’s required to lead. Throw out the old rulebook and put Open Leadership into play.” —Keith Ferrazzi, New York Times bestselling author
“If you are in a quandary about how to use social media and social technologies, Open Leadership is a book for you. It provides a road map for corporate leaders grappling with how to use social media in a thoughtful, disciplined way.” —Renée Mauborgne, coauthor of Blue Ocean Strategy
“Yet again Charlene Li is pioneering how companies must transform themselves to be successful in a global economy in a digital world. Her insights will inspire executives to rethink old approaches and adopt new ways of thinking and operating: Open Leadership is about how companies can leverage multiple networks of customers, researchers, developers, manufacturers, and other partners, etc., to drive innovation, achieve efficiencies, and grow.” —Larry Weber, chairman, W2 Group, Inc.
“In this great work, Charlene Li details through rich stories just how some institutions are opening up and, in the process, earning the trust of millions.” —Steve Rubel, SVP/director of Insights for Edelman Digital
“Charlene show that tapping into the power of social technologies isn’t about mastering the latest shiny technologies, but instead having a clear idea of the relationships you want to form with your stakeholders. A must-read for those eager to embrace ‘the new openness.’” —Roger Martin, dean, Rotman School of Management, University of Toronto
